Tie display band wrap
A tie display band wrap is disclosed which comprises a band having a first end, a second end, a top edge, and a bottom edge, a tab portion extending from the bottom edge, a display portion positioned on the band, and a securing assembly.
This disclosure relates generally to a retail merchandise display to promote the sale of merchandise, and more particularly, to a tie display band wrap used to display and wrap a tie.
Displays for neckwear or ties to distinguish tie manufacturers or specific ties from one another are available. One display device is a display hanger in which a tie is hung from the display hanger and hung from a display device such as a rack. However, a display hanger has a few problems associated with its use. One problem is that the display hanger and the tie are easily knocked off the display device and fall to the ground. A second problem is that once the display hanger is removed from the display device it may be difficult to replace the display hanger back on the display device. Another device for displaying ties may be a table upon which ties are placed. Again, there are a few problems when using a table as a display device. One problem is that if an individual is looking for a particular brand an individual will have to flip each tie over to determine the brand. Another problem is that once the tie is flipped over it may be difficult to place the tie back in the same position or the tie may come undone and be difficult to fold back to its original position. Various other display devices are used to display ties with one display device being an alpha display. However, once the ties are placed in the various shelves of an alpha display it is difficult to determine the brand of the tie without removing the tie from the alpha display. Therefore, there is a need to provide a device that may be employed to easily display a tie. It would also be advantageous to be able to provide a device that will hold or wrap a tie so that when the tie is removed from a display it will be easy to replace the tie in the display in the same condition or position that the tie was in prior to removal of the tie from the display.

In order to assemble the wrap 10 the wrap 10 may be folded along the fold lines 28, 30, 32, and 34. The tab portion 22 is inserted through one or both of the keepers 48 and 50 and the extension portions 36 and 38 are used to hook the tab portion 22 against the keepers 48 and 50 to hold the tab portion 22 in place. The wrap 10 is folded around the tie 42 and the securing assembly 26 is used to secure the second end 16 to the first end 14. If required, the tie display body wrap 10 may be removed from the tie 42 by releasing the securing assembly 26 and sliding the tab portion 22 out from the keepers 48 and 50. In this manner the wrap 10 may be reused or discarded.

It should be recognized that the tie display band wraps 10 and 100 of the present disclosure could be constructed of various materials such as paper, cardboard, plastic, metal, cloth or other woven materials. Preferably, the wraps 10 and 100 will be formed of relatively lightweight material so that the wraps 10 and 100 can be easily manufactured, assembled, positioned, secured in place, removed, transported, and stored. Further, the wraps 10 and 100 can be constructed of relatively inexpensive materials that will provide for the wraps 10 and 100 to be mass produced, disposable, and suitable for one time use. It is also possible that the tie display band wraps 10 and 100 can be formed of various other shapes or configurations than the various shapes and configurations depicted herein. For example, the display portion 24 of the wrap 10 can be circular in shape rather than rectangular.
